Terrance Johnson Earns SWAC First-Team Nod As Men’s & Women’s Places Fourth At Conference Championship

10/23/2023 6:08:00 PM

Pine Bluff, AR.- On a meet day featuring a lot of solid competition, the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ff men's and women's cross country provided a strong showing at the 2023 SWAC Conference Championship in Tallahassee, FL., at the Apalachee Regional Park.

Both programs placed in the top four overall with a score of (96 pts.) on the men's side and (110 pts.) on the women's side. Junior Terrance Johnson was named to the all-conference first-team.

On the women's side (5K), UAPB had three runners placed in the top 25, led by senior Akili Pleas Carnie, who placed 12th with a time of 20:53.2. Senior Abigail Pinnock was next across the finish line for the Golden Lions at the 21st slot with a time of 21:04.0, followed by sophomore Kris-Ann Plummer, who placed 22nd with a time of 21:07.1.

Junior Shaunia McFarlane placed 26th with a time of 21:20.1, followed by junior Kaiel Kimble, who placed 29th with a time of 21:29.8, while junior Jada Turner finished 34th with a time of 21:49.4 to round out the showing for UAPB. 

On the men's side (8K), Johnson led the pack, placing fifth with a time of 27:27.3. Freshman Inertia Mugethi made his first conference championship debut, placing 12th with a time of 28:01.4, followed by senior Rio Williams, who placed 19th with a time of 25:51.4 wrapping up the Golden Lions scoring in the top-25.

Junior Ryan Longmire placed 28th with a time of 29:36.1, along with junior Genesis Joseph, who crossed the finished line in 32nd with a time of 30:11.3, and senior Tarik Xavier rounded out at 55th with a time of 37:53.4.
